Obituary of Donald D. Hagins

Donald Dean Hagins passed away in Hollister on August 6, 2016 at age 91 years and ten months. Don was born on October 22, 1924 to Clovis and Audrey Hagins in Jericho Springs, MO. He was the youngest of four siblings. Don’s family made the decision to move to California for a better life and moved to Hollister in 1936. Don attended Hollister Grammar School and there he met his life-long friend and future brother in law, Dave Porteur. Sports and family would remain key parts of the remainder of his life. At San Benito High School Don played football for the Balers and was a member of the Class of 1943. World War II interrupted the lives and schooling of many teenage boys and Don answered Uncle Sam’s call and joined the U.S Navy. Don went overseas in late 1943 and spent the next two years on board a 110’ long Submarine Chaser (SC-1040) in the South Pacific. Don came home from the war and was honorably discharged in early 1946. Like so many servicemen returning home from war he quickly found work as a welder/fabricator working for his brother in law Walter Wiebe. Don spent the next forty years with the same company taking on more responsibility becoming foreman and eventually production manager at Wiebe Mfg and then Raymond Production Systems which purchased Wiebe Mfg. In 1953 Don married his soul-mate and the love of his life, Marian Sanchez. His best friend, Dave Porteur was married to Marian’s sister Anne and Don and Dave were usually found over the BBQ pits cooking for family gatherings. Don was a Little League Coach with his brother in law Frank Sanchez during the 1950’s and was later president of the Hollister Babe Ruth League during the mid 1970’s. He was President of the Baler Backers club during that time as well. An avid golfer for years Don was a member of the Bolado Park Golf Club. He will be remembered for his many years as President of the Bolado Park Golf Club. Don was a member of the Hollister VFW. Family always came first to Don and Marian Hagins and their home was always warm and welcoming to all. Don retired in 1989 and he and Marian enjoyed the remaining years God had allotted them. Marian passed away in 2011. For the remainder of his life he was surrounded by his sons, their wives, grandchildren and many friends. The staff at the Mabie Center provided much loving care and support during Don’s last years. Don was an honorable Man and knew His Lord and Savior Jesus Christ.
